Methods for Thickening Milk Naturally
There are several methods and ingredients that can be used to thicken milk naturally, each with its unique characteristics, advantages, and best use cases. Here are some of the most common and effective natural thickeners for milk:
- Tapioca Starch: Derived from cassava root, tapioca starch is a popular thickener due to its neutral flavor and high thickening ability. It’s especially useful in dairy-based desserts.
- Arrowroot Powder: Another root-derived thickener, arrowroot powder is versatile and can be used in both sweet and savory dishes. It’s known for its easy digestion and is a good choice for those with sensitive stomachs.
Using Gelatin and Agar Agar
Gelatin and agar agar are two thickeners that work by gelling the liquid when cooled, making them ideal for desserts and puddings. Gelatin is an animal-derived protein and is a traditional choice for thickening milk in desserts like puddings and custards. On the other hand, agar agar, derived from red algae, is a vegan alternative that provides a similar gelling effect without the use of animal products.
Thickening with Seeds and Grains
Seeds like chia and flax, and grains such as oats, can also be used to thicken milk naturally. These thickeners work by absorbing liquid and swelling, thus increasing the viscosity of the mixture. Chia seeds are particularly effective and nutritious, adding not only thickness but also omega-3 fatty acids and fiber to the milk.

Tips for Thickening Milk Effectively
To achieve the best results when thickening milk naturally, it’s essential to follow a few key tips:
– Always mix the thickener with a small amount of cold milk or water before adding it to the hot milk to avoid lumps.
– Start with a small amount of thickener and gradually add more as needed, as it’s easier to add more thickener than it is to thin out the mixture.
– Consider the cooking time and method, as some thickeners may require heating to activate their thickening properties, while others may lose their effectiveness when heated.
